Bibliography: pages 133-139. / The extensive series of cyclopentadienyl transition metal complexes known, has made of interest the corresponding chemistry of pentamethylcyclopentadienyl transition metal derivatives, and other substituted cyclopentdienyl species. In the study two synthetic routes are described for the synthesis of new halomethyl complexes of molybdenum, tungsten and iron.
